Curiosity takes me across disciplines.
I'm a rising senior at Emory University double majoring in Applied Mathematics and Chemistry on the pre-MD/PhD track. I'm most energized by work that combines analytical thinking, creativity, and tangible impact.
At Emory, I analyze physiological data in Dr. Negar Fani's lab, teach quantum chemistry, and have worked on applied AI research with the Chemistry Department. Outside campus, I build software and operational systems for local businesses and tutor and mentor students.
I also previously served in finance and operations leadership with the Global Indigenous Health Coalition through July 2026. Whether I'm working with data, code, a classroom, or a team, I like taking complicated problems and building something useful from them.
